Example of completed documentation using this template
John Doe visited for a hearing aid check of s10.ai Phonak Audeo Marvel devices. He mentioned experiencing occasional feedback and challenges hearing in noisy settings.Otoscopy: Otoscopy was unremarkable in both ears. Cerumen management was advised, and consent was obtained. Wax removal was performed in the right ear using irrigation.Both hearing aids were cleaned and inspected, including replacing the domes and wax traps. The sound quality of the hearing aids was satisfactory. The hearing aids were run in Redux, which indicated the removal of 5 microliters of moisture.In response to the patient's concerns about feedback and difficulty in noisy environments, the following adjustments, changes, and recommendations were made: The audiologist modified the gain settings to minimize feedback and provided guidance on utilizing the directional microphone feature in noisy situations.It was advised that John return in 6 months for a hearing aid check, which he will call to schedule. The patient was encouraged to call and return sooner if any issues or concerns arise. An after-visit summary was provided to the patient.
